How Voice Recognition Technology is Changing Telemarketing Automation

Telemarketing has undergone a radical transformation, especially with the introduction of voice recognition technology. This innovative approach aims to streamline communication between businesses and potential customers. By integrating voice recognition systems, telemarketers can ensure a more personalized interaction. These systems analyze speech patterns, enabling agents to engage effectively and understand customer needs. Voice recognition allows for the inclusion of real-time feedback, which is beneficial in improving service quality. Furthermore, the technology can automate certain routine tasks, freeing agents to focus on higher-value interactions. This leads to increased efficiency and better use of resources. Businesses can optimize their time management and improve conversion rates through automation. Adopting such technology also involves enhanced data collection, allowing for richer customer profiles. With more information, companies can tailor their pitches and offers better, increasing the probability of successful sales. Thus, the synergy of voice recognition technology and telemarketing automation is not just about reducing costs; it enhances customer experience, driving better outcomes for companies and clients alike. Overall, the impact of voice recognition on telemarketing is substantial and growing significantly, setting new industry standards.

Enhancing Customer Experience Through Automation

Improving customer experience is paramount in the competitive world of telemarketing, and voice recognition is pivotal in creating more engaging interactions. By utilizing this technology, customer inquiries are handled promptly, allowing for swift responses to questions and concerns. Advanced algorithms analyze keywords to prioritize customer queries, ensuring that the most pressing issues are addressed first. This level of responsiveness fosters trust and loyalty among consumers. Additionally, automation through voice recognition allows for 24/7 availability, providing customers access to services regardless of time. This convenience appeals significantly to modern consumers who demand flexibility and efficiency. Moreover, the ability to customize interactions based on previous conversations enhances the efficacy of sales pitches. Personalized experiences make customers feel valued and appreciated, further motivating them to proceed with purchases. As businesses implement voice recognition tools, they also glean insights into customer preferences and behaviors, enabling them to refine their marketing strategies effectively. This data-driven approach allows for more accurate forecasting of trends and needs within the target audience. As technology continues to advance, telemarketing strategies will increasingly embrace these innovations to meet evolving customer demands while establishing stronger relationships.

Cost Efficiency and Resource Allocation

Implementing voice recognition technology brings considerable cost efficiency to telemarketing automation, which translates into better resource allocation. Organizations typically face challenges with labor costs, especially when managing large volumes of calls. Voice recognition systems significantly reduce the necessity for extensive human resources while handling repetitive tasks seamlessly. As a result, companies may redirect their budgets towards enhancing quality over quantity, ultimately leading to improved overall service. This strategic reallocation allows for a greater focus on specialized roles that require nuanced human engagement, fostering a more skilled and knowledgeable workforce. Moreover, the reduction in training time presents another cost-saving advantage. With more intuitive technology, new hires can be onboarded quickly, reducing time-to-productivity. Additionally, operational costs diminish when organizations implement scalable automated services. These systems accommodate fluctuations in demand without inflating expenses. Furthermore, tracking customer interactions becomes straightforward, leading to fewer inefficiencies within departmental operations. Consequently, as telemarketing firms adopt voice recognition, they create opportunities for innovation and improved profitability. Thus, the relationship between automation and financial health becomes evident, reinforcing how technology serves as a catalyst for better business practices in telemarketing.
